PM’s office said to fume after Likud MK says ‘we’re on verge’ of attack on Iran this weekend

Backbencher Moshe Saada later claims he was referring to US, not Israel, attacking Iran, as Trump says he's weighing major strike; official: Saada 'knows nothing, he's just blathering'

Likud MK Moshe Saada sparked controversy on Thursday after stating in a TV interview that Israel was "on the verge of an attack in Iran — perhaps even this weekend." The Prime Minister's Office reportedly reacted with anger, leading Saada to clarify on X that he was referring to a potential US attack, not an Israeli one. Officials quickly dismissed his comments, with one stating, "He doesn’t know anything, he’s just blathering." Following the incident, Likud reportedly instructed its lawmakers to refrain from public statements about the war. This development occurred as US President Donald Trump has also threatened a "massive attack" on Iran, indicating Israel "would join in two minutes if I asked them to."
